I just finished the last story in my queue (to be posted tomorrow) so I plan to open commissions again in the next couple days. I'm gonna be bumping my prices a bit, but I'm not sure how much.
I think I gave myself the wrong impression when I got started - I looked for other people taking commissions and the first one I found was a fairly popular writer with actual published work, so I assumed they had a pretty good idea of how to price stuff. But now that I'm looking at other writers, it seems like they were really underpriced compared to most people, so I'm not sure what to charge.
For context, here's the price bump I was working with before looking up other writers' prices:
$5 planning fee PLUS
1000-4000 words: $12/1000 words
5000-7000 words: $15/1000 words
8000-10,000 words: $20/1000 words
These prices put me cheaper than most of the other writers I'm seeing on here, and kiiiinda on the lower end of my preferred hourly rate (I price most art stuff to put me roughly in the $10-$15/hour range - my most recent work would've made me about $10-11/hour with those prices). So my question is, should I raise them more? I'd be more comfortable if I did, but I don't want to go out of too many people's budgets. If you were to commission a story, what would your general budget be? Alternatively, how much would you expect to pay for a 2-3 page short story (~1k words) or the equivalent of an average book chapter (~4k words)?
